To achieve reliable cost and effort estimates, a number of options arise:1.Delay estimation until late in the project [since, we can achieve 100%accurate estimates after the project is complete!]2.Base estimates on similar projects that have already been completed.3.Use relatively simple decomposition techniques to generate project costand effort estimates.4. Use one or more empirical models for software cost and effortestimation.Unfortunately, the first option, however attractive, is not practical. Cost estimatesmust be provided “Up front”. However, we should recognize that the longer wewait, the more we know, and the more we know, the less likely we are to makeserious errors in our estimates.The second option can work reasonably well, if the current project is quitesimilar to past efforts and other project influences [e.g., the customer, businessconditions, the SEE, deadlines] are equivalent. Unfortunately past experience hasnot always been a good indicator of future results.The remaining options are viable approaches the software project estimation.Ideally, the techniques noted for each option be applied in tandem; each used ascross check for the other.Decomposition techniquestake a “divide and conquer”approach to software project estimation. By decomposing a project into majorfunctions and related software engineering activities, cost and effort estimation canbe performed in the stepwise fashion.Empirical estimationmodels can be used to complement decompositiontechniques and offer a potentially valuable estimation approach in their own right. Amodel based on experience [historical data] and takes the form

D = f [vi]Where d is one of a number of estimated values [e.g., effort, cost, projectduration and we are selected independent parameters [e.g., estimated LOC [line ofcode]].Each of the viable softwarecost estimationoptions is only as good as thehistorical data used to seed the estimate. If no historical data exist, costing rests on avery shaky foundation.

4.1 PERT ChartProgram evaluation and review technique [PERT] and critical path method[CPM] are two project scheduling methods that can be applied to softwaredevelopment. These techniques are driven by following information:Estimates of EffortA decomposition of the product functionThe selection of the appropriate process model and task setDecomposition of tasksPERT chart for this application software is illustrated in figure 3.1. The criticalPath for this Project is Design, Code generation and Integration and testing.Aug-2008Figure 4.1 PERTcharts for “University Study CenterManagement SystemManagement System”.4.2 Gantt ChartGantt chart which is also known as Timeline chart contains the informationlike effort, duration, start date, completion date for each task. A timeline chart canbe developed for the entire project.
